Job Description:
Our team is actively seeking a Contracts Specialist to join the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ance (ISR) business area. This position is responsible for a diverse business area, with defense customers from various USG Departments and Agencies, as well as large and small business prime contractors.
The Contracts Specialist will administer, extend, negotiate, and terminate standard and nonstandard contracts. Conducts proposal preparation, contract negotiation, contract administration, and customer contact activities to provide for proper contract acquisition and fulfillment in accordance with company policies, legal requirements, and customer specifications. Examines estimates of material, equipment services, production costs, performance requirements, and delivery schedules to ensure accuracy and completeness. Prepares bids; processes specifications, progress, and other reports; advises management of contractual rights and obligations; compiles and analyzes data; and maintains historical information.
Essential Functions:
- Preparing contractual letters, Terms & Conditions, Representations & Certifications for proposals to the U.S. Government and other DoD Contractors
- Providing audit and fact-finding support for major proposals
- Administering and closing contracts
- Compiling information and reports
- Interpreting contract requirements and track contractual performance to the requirements
- Working with customers, management, and program teams to resolve issues, secure approvals, and ensure successful contract execution
- Serving as the primary liaison for contractual communications between L3Harris and our customers
- Ensuring compliance with federal procurement regulatory requirements
- Assisting procurement personnel with contracting tasks, including establishing flow-down terms and conditions.
- Utilizes knowledge of regulations including the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R), FAR supplements (e.g. DFARS) and other agency regulations.
- Ability to read and interpret contracts and statements of work (SOW)
- Ability to manage multiple projects and prioritize appropriately
- Must possess strong attention to detail, with the ability to identify discrepancies and inconsistencies in data and documents, ensuring high levels of accuracy and quality in all work outputs.
- Performing other duties as assigned
